Retro Gadgets - seya

Hello Gadgeteers!

We're excited to share with you the new update of Retro Gadgets, available from today.

In this new version you'll find:

  • New WiFi Chip function: WebGetAudioStream – stream audio straight from the web!

  • New property to list all open audio streams

  • New GIF recorder: when publishing the gadget on the workshop it's now possible to record an animated gif

  • WiFi Chip can now fetch images too – you can have PixelData as a response

  • New Video Chip functions: DrawCustomRenderBuffer and RasterCustomRenderBuffer for drawing only parts of a RenderBuffer

  • Fixed alpha blend in SetPixelBuffer and RasterRenderBuffer

  • Code editor can now run in fullscreen

Tons of crash fixes and stability improvements

Killing Floor 3 - Yoshiro

Nightfall,

With the Rearmament Update headed your way this month, we wanted to take the time to share more of the changes you can expect. We’ve already covered Weapon Balance in the previous Nightfall News, and today we want to focus on performance, zed balance and more.

The first thing we want to highlight is Performance and Stability Improvements! The team has worked on over 100 individual optimization tasks that should improve overall player performance as well as minimize and increase performance during “spikes”, leading to smoother gameplay on many systems.  More performance improvements are expected to make their way into the Winter Update.

Switching to gameplay, the first item is a new feature: Zed Bump Physics. What does that mean? Players falling on or sliding into Zeds that are not attacking can now stumble, knock them down and even obliterate them. We can’t wait to see how you incorporate this new feature into your playstyle!

Another balance area we want to highlight today is Zeds. They’ve received work focused on making them more predictable to dodge in various scenarios as well as various tweaks to improve the combat flow:

  • All Non-Boss Enemies

    • Updated to allow afflictions that can interrupt to cancel out executions of enemies against players. This also fixes an issue where destroying a limb during an enemy's execution against a player did not disrupt it.

  • Bloat

    • Adjustments to the rotations and distance triggers of multiple abilities to improve gameplay for dodging.

  • Chimera

    • Disabled the use of the longer version of the Phase 2 Mire Energy Ball ability for Normal Difficulty.

    • Adjustments to damage radii and rotations of multiple melee abilities to improve gameplay for dodging.

  • Clot & Mire Clot

    • Adjustments to the rotations and damage volumes of abilities to improve gameplay for dodging.

  • Crawler & Crawler Larva

    • Adjustments to the rotations of multiple melee abilities to improve gameplay for dodging.

  • Cyst & Mire Cyst

    • Adjustments to the rotations and damage volumes of abilities to improve gameplay for dodging.

  • Fleshpound

    • Adjustments to the rotations of multiple melee abilities to improve gameplay for dodging.

  • Gorefast

    • Adjustments to the rotations and distance triggers of abilities to improve gameplay for dodging.

  • Husk

    • Fireball attack is 30% slower to give more time to shoot the barrel before it fires. The homing of the projectile has also been reduced by 40%

    • Added impulse to the Flamethrower ability.

    • Adjustments to the rotations of multiple melee abilities to improve gameplay for dodging.

  • Impaler

    • Reduced the damage dealt by the charge and leap parts of its Charge ability by 50%. The slam part of the Charge ability deals the same damage as before.

    • Adjustments to damage radii and rotations of multiple melee abilities to improve gameplay for dodging.

  • Queen Crawler

    • Adjustments to damage radii and rotations of multiple melee abilities to improve gameplay for dodging.

  • Scrake

    • Adjustments to the rotations of multiple melee abilities to improve gameplay for dodging.

    • It now takes way more hits before the zed will attempt to block incoming damage. The Zed will also leave block stance 2x faster if no more incoming damage is happening.

  • Fleshpound 

    • It now takes way more hits before the zed will attempt to block incoming damage. The Zed will also leave block stance 2x faster if no more incoming damage is happening.

  • Siren

    • Reduced projectile speed of sonic projectiles by 37.5%.

    • Added distance restriction of target being at least further than 4 meters before allowing use of ability.

    • Removed homing (there was a slight homing aspect on this projectile).

Along with these changes, players will now find it much harder to miss when the large Zeds have arrived and will enjoy more satisfying audio when they score those head shots! The last item we want to highlight today is the over 700 individual bug fixes that have taken place.

VT-5

The VT-5 is a modern Chinese Light Tank that was developed specifically with export in mind. There are many reasons why a country without its own tank development should opt to purchase a Light Tank instead of a full-scale Main Battle Tank. It’s equally as fast if not faster with equal firepower but, what is most important, it is affordable. The VT-5 excels in all these categories. While its armor cannot match that of an MBT, it can protect its crew against most infantry threats thanks to its ERA and cage armor sets. It also has a powerful 105mm gun capable of firing guided missiles, it is packed with advanced electronics and is supremely agile thanks to its 1000hp diesel engine. Simply put, wraps cutting edge technologies up into an affordable bundle. You can learn more about it in a dedicated article.

In Armored Warfare, the VT-5 is a very powerful Tier 9 Premium Light Tank. Fast and agile, it features solid levels of protection (the configuration in the game is the one featuring the ERA kit as well as the turret cage armor) and a good rate of fire. Additionally, its gun is capable of firing guided missiles. It’s an ideal machine for players who value speed and agility, as it offers plenty of both. The VT-5 is capable of dancing around its opponents on the battlefield, outperforming even some AFVs in mobility.

QN-506

The QN-506 fire support vehicle is a Chinese attempt to design a cheap, export-oriented alternative to the Russian BMPT series. Instead of converting a second or third generation MBT, the engineers at Wuhan Guide Infrared Co., Ltd., likely to keep the vehicle as affordable as possible, opted to base their project on the Type 59 MBT, which is, in its basic form anyway, a copy of the old Soviet T-55 medium tank from the late 1950s. They jam-packed it with cutting edge electronics and a number of weapon systems, including ATGMs, an automatic cannon or smaller caliber rockets. However, despite the use of an unmanned turret, the protection levels of this vehicle are still quite low and, so far, there haven’t been any signs of interest in the QN-506. You can learn more about this vehicle in our dedicated article.

In Armored Warfare, the QN-506 is a Premium Tier 9 Tank Destroyer that gameplay-wise resembles the popular BMPT series. However, unlike the Russian Terminators, it has a number of interesting features including three different weapon systems (30mm cannon, 70mm unguided rockets and 151mm ATGMs) and loitering recon ammunition flying towards the end of a map and spotting everything in its path. The last ability is unique to the QN-506 and makes it one of the most potent support vehicles on the battlefield.

Forever Skies - RumHam871115
Greetings scientists.

It’s time for another development update, but in this one we’re coming with release date(s) and details on how the update will be delivered.

First bit of info, we’ve decided to name this update “Echoes”. For those unaware, these are a series of changes we have been working on and talking about here that are coming to Forever Skies based on community feedback which you can see here:

We’re calling the update Echoes because much of the content is thematically built around the lives and stories of those who were on Earth before the game starts. These echoes of the past will help you get a better feel and connection for how the world was functioning before the final collapse of humanity, and from the expedition teams that were sent before ours.



The next big announcement is how this will be delivered. Originally, we planned to release these changes as one massive update with overhauls to all 3 biomes and multiple new systems all landing at the same time. However, after careful consideration, we’ve decided it will be more sensible to split these into three distinct parts. This new approach will allow us to:

  • Deliver changes and new content more quickly
  • Build stronger foundations of the new systems to be applied in the next updates
  • Gather your feedback earlier to ensure the quality of the next updates
Most importantly, it means you won’t have to wait half a year to experience what we’ve been working on because, as it stands, had we kept this as one massive update, we’d be releasing this sometime in Spring 2026. We’re still a small team, and because these updates take time, we need to balance this out without being “content silent” for so much time.

We hope this line of thinking makes sense to players. Below is our planned roadmap for the 3 parts, along with a small write-up of each.

Echoes Update Roadmap


Echoes Part 1 – Coming November 17, 2025
Biome 1: The Silent City

So for Echoes Part 1, the update will mainly focus on adding changes to Biome 1: The Silent City and will set the stage for everything that follows. Most importantly, we’ll introduce the core systems that will help create more diverse locations and generate the side quests. If these foundations work as intended, we’ll then be able to confidently use them, to also add to Biomes 2 and 3 in terms of additional location diversity and side quest content.
So highlights include:

  • A brand-new side quest system debuting in this biome
  • The long-awaited Radio Tower overhaul, which will enable more varied exploration and discoveries (more details in our earlier post here: Link)
  • Extractor Upgrading to create a more rewarding progression path with the extractor.
We’re also happy to announce that this update is planned to go live on Monday, November 17, 2025.

We will also be launching a Steam beta with Echoes Part 1 content in the next couple of days so we can get your first round of feedback in for what we’ve been working on so far. Keep an eye out here or on social media once we make the beta live.


Echoes Part 2 – Coming December 2025
Biome 2: The Overgrown Ruins

Echoes Part 2 brings new content mainly to Biome 2: The Overgrown Ruins. Highlights will include:
  • Biome 2 side quests and stories
  • New airship decor items
  • A seasonal event to close out the year, inspired by previous community favorites
Since the team will be taking some well-deserved time off during the holidays, Part 2 will be slightly smaller in scale. However, we wanted to end the year with something enjoyable that continues to expand the game’s world. We’ve also seen from feedback that The Overgrown Ruins Biome doesn’t give players such a strong feel of repetition compared to Biome 1, so if all things go as planned we should have this update ready for mid-to-late December.


Echoes Part 3 – Coming Spring 2026
Biome 3: New Nature

Finally, we’ll have Echoes Part 3, potentially the largest of the three updates.
Part 3 focuses mainly on changes that will apply to Biome 3: New Nature, but also some that touch the whole game experience. Highlights include:

  • Biome 3 side quests and stories
  • New dangers, enemies and environmental challenges
  • Custom difficulty settings, allowing players to tailor their experience to their preferred level of challenge and atmosphere
As you can see, each part of Echoes builds on the last. By delivering the update in stages, we can ensure each layer of content is well-tuned and informed by your feedback to move on to the next.


Each Update Will Bring More Than Shown Here

We feel it’s important to highlight that the roadmap in this post just highlights the big changes we have planned a, but there will also be a long and extensive list of additional content and QoL improvements that will be laid out in detail closer to release. These updates will also come with additional new bug fixes, more optimization, and of course, things that come from your feedback.

And just like before, we will of course still be pushing out any hotfixes that we see need urgent attention, just as we have continually done so since the full launch of the game.


Your Existing Saves Will Be Fine

As some of you may have already noticed, some of our planned changes will alter the overall progression of the game, and you might be worried about your existing saves. As it stands, we see nothing that should force you to restart the game from scratch.

This applies to all three parts of the update. There will, of course, be some minor things that won’t fit in as seamlessly as if you were starting fresh, but rest assured that your existing airships are safe, and the bulk of our changes will work fine regardless of where you are starting or continuing from.

STARHOME - Pandasvk

Greetings, Galaxy Explorers!

In our last post, many of you asked how the travelling phase works — and if you guessed that there’s a Galaxy Map where all your journey planning takes place… you were absolutely right!

Galaxy Map

The Galaxy Map is one of the core features of Starhome. This is where you’ll carefully plan your path from one star system to another.

Your choices matter — there are many variables to consider along the way:

  • Some are well known and predictable.

  • Some are uncertain and will require careful planning.

  • And others remain completely unknown, waiting to surprise you.

In the video above, we’ve revealed what every system in the galaxy contains — but don’t expect things to be that easy once your journey begins!

The map will provide you with basic travel information, such as:

  • Estimated travel time

  • Fuel required for the trip

Occasionally, you may also discover hints from nearby systems. These clues can give you valuable intel — for example:

  • Warnings about possible dangers

  • Signs of rich mineral asteroids

  • …and many other opportunities or threats.
